debian

Debian回收站工作原理是什么

小樊
45
2025-09-27 08:31:25
栏目: 智能运维

Debian系统“回收站”的工作原理
Debian作为类Unix系统,本身未内置传统图形界面的“回收站”功能,但通过用户级垃圾文件夹命令行回收工具底层文件系统机制,实现了类似“回收站”的文件安全管理能力。以下是具体工作原理的详细说明:

1. 垃圾文件夹(Trash):用户级回收机制

Debian的“回收站”主要通过**~/.local/share/Trash目录实现(隐藏目录,需用ls -a查看),其工作流程符合FreeDesktop.org垃圾规范**,具体步骤如下:

2. 命令行回收工具:增强型垃圾管理

为满足命令行用户需求,Debian推荐使用Trash-Cli工具(符合垃圾规范),提供更灵活的回收功能:

3. 底层文件系统机制:文件删除的本质

即使使用垃圾文件夹,文件删除的底层仍遵循Unix文件系统逻辑

4. 补充:数据恢复工具的“准回收”功能

若文件未进入垃圾文件夹(如直接使用rm命令删除),可通过数据恢复工具扫描磁盘剩余数据块,尝试还原文件:

综上,Debian的“回收站”功能通过用户级垃圾文件夹实现可视化回收,通过命令行工具增强操作灵活性,底层依赖文件系统机制保留数据可恢复性,同时辅以数据恢复工具应对误删场景。这种组合既满足了普通用户的需求,也为高级用户提供了更多选择。

0
看了该问题的人还看了